The dice game [Yacht](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Yacht_(dice_game)) is from
the same family as Poker Dice, Generala and particularly Yahtzee, of which it
is a precursor. In the game, five dice are rolled and the result can be entered
in any of twelve categories. The score of a throw of the dice depends on
category chosen.
